Environmental-friendly pest management techniques refer to strategies and methods that aim to control pests in a way that minimizes harm to the environment and non-target species.
Key Features
- Use of biological controls
- Integrated pest management practices
- Reduction of pesticide use
- Focus on prevention rather than eradication
Pros
- Minimizes harm to the environment
- Reduces pesticide exposure to humans and non-target organisms
- Encourages sustainable farming practices
Cons
- May require more time and effort compared to conventional pest control methods
- Can be less effective in some cases
